How To Fix AQV236 - Query &1 for user group &2 does not exist


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: AQV - Message texts for SAP Query

  • Message number: 236

  • Message text: Query &1 for user group &2 does not exist

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    You tried to copy a query that does not exist.

    System Response

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

    How to fix this error?

    Select the right name for the query and user group.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message AQV236 - Query &1 for user group &2 does not exist ?

    The SAP error message AQV236 indicates that a query (or report) specified in the system does not exist for the specified user group. This typically occurs in the context of SAP Query or SAP Query-related transactions where a user attempts to access a query that has not been defined or is not available for the specified user group.

    Cause:

    1. Non-existent Query: The query you are trying to access has not been created or has been deleted.
    2. Incorrect User Group: The user group specified does not have the query assigned to it.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the query or the user group.
    4. Transport Issues: If the query was transported from another system, it may not have been transported correctly or may not exist in the target system.

    Solution:

    1. Check Query Existence:

      • Go to the SAP Query transaction (SQ01) and check if the query exists for the specified user group.
      • If it does not exist, you may need to create it or assign it to the user group.
    2. Verify User Group:

      • Ensure that you are using the correct user group. You can check the user group assignments in the SAP system.
      • If necessary, change the user group to one that has access to the query.
    3. Create or Assign Query:

      • If the query does not exist, you can create a new query using transaction SQ01.
      • If the query exists but is not assigned to the user group, you can assign it using transaction SQ02 (for user groups) or SQ03 (for user group assignments).
    4. Check Authorizations:

      •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the query and the user group. This may involve checking roles and profiles assigned to the user.
    5. Transport Issues:

      • If the query was supposed to be transported from another system, check the transport logs to ensure it was transported successfully.
      • If it was not transported, you may need to manually create the query in the target system.
